首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在android中显示进度对话框

在Android中显示进度对话框可以通过ProgressDialog实现。ProgressDialog是一种用于显示任务进度的对话框,它可以在后台任务执行时向用户展示进度条和相关信息。

要在Android中显示进度对话框,可以按照以下步骤进行操作:

  1. 创建ProgressDialog对象:ProgressDialog progressDialog = new ProgressDialog(context);
  2. 设置ProgressDialog的样式和属性:progressDialog.setProgressStyle(ProgressDialog.STYLE_SPINNER); // 设置进度条样式为圆形 progressDialog.setMessage("加载中..."); // 设置进度条显示的文本信息 progressDialog.setCancelable(false); // 设置是否可以通过返回键取消对话框
  3. 显示ProgressDialog:progressDialog.show();
  4. 在后台任务执行完成后,隐藏ProgressDialog:progressDialog.dismiss();

ProgressDialog还提供了一些其他的方法,可以根据需要进行设置,例如设置进度条的最大值、当前进度、进度条是否显示进度百分比等。

进度对话框在Android开发中常用于展示耗时操作的进度,例如网络请求、数据加载等。它可以提升用户体验,让用户清楚地知道任务的进度情况。

腾讯云相关产品中,可以使用腾讯移动分析(https://cloud.tencent.com/product/mta)来分析应用的使用情况和性能数据,帮助开发者优化应用体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分59秒

25_应用练习2_扫描并显示扫描进度.avi

20分50秒

day03_58_尚硅谷_硅谷p2p金融_使用自定义属性设置圆形进度条的显示

7分42秒

15_应用练习2_显示列表.avi

12分22秒

32.尚硅谷_JNI_让 C 的输出能显示在 Logcat 中.avi

22分35秒

day03_54_尚硅谷_硅谷p2p金融_HomeFragment中显示联网数据

4分30秒

day04_78_尚硅谷_硅谷p2p金融_提供加载中显示的drawable动画

8分32秒

day05_90_尚硅谷_硅谷p2p金融_MeFragment中读取已登录信息显示

-

安卓8.0时代它也将淘汰?3.5mm耳机孔消亡史

15分47秒

day17_项目三/18-尚硅谷-Java语言基础-项目三TeamView中显示开发团队成员

10分27秒

day17_项目三/17-尚硅谷-Java语言基础-项目三TeamView中显示所有员工的功能

领券